Calcolo periodo contributivo

sabato 11 febbraio 2017 - 14.51
Tag Elenco Tags  VB.NET  |  .NET 4.0  |  Visual Studio 2010

Mau67 Profilo | Expert

Buon pomeriggio al forum,
come vedete nel titolo ho la necessita di estrapolare le date di lavoro fatte nelle varie aziende durante tutta la carriera lavorativa.
Come si sviluppa la cosa:
In una listview1 carico tutti i periodi di lavoro presso le aziende
01/01/1986 al 22/04/1988 azienda 1
23/04/1988 al 31/12/1991 azienda 2
01/01/1992 al 01/03/1992 non lavorato
02/03/1992 al 24/08/2000 azienda 3
25/08/2000 al 04/05/2010 azienda 4
05/05/2010 al 30/12/2016 azienda 5

in un altra listview2 ci sono le date per il calcolo della contribuzione:
01/01/1998
01/01/2000
01/01/2010

poi ci sono 2 textbox dove nella textbox1 inserisco la data di prima assunzione
e nella textbox2 metto la data di pensione

textbox1=01/01/1986
textbox2 = 30/09/2016
Dovrei inserire le date ricalcolate per periodo di contribuzione nella listview3
la prima data sara la data di assunzione presa dalla textbox1 la data termine sara la data della listview1 e l'azienda1
la prima sara 01/01/1986 al 22/04/1988 azienda 1
la seconda riga sara 23/04/1988 al 31/12/1991 azienda 2
la terza riga sara 02/03/1992 al 31/12/1997 azienda 3 <<< qui viene spezzato il periodo in base alla listview2
la quarta riga sara 01/01/1998 al 24/08/2000 azienda 3 <<< qui il periodo ricomincia in base alla listview2
la quinta riga sara 25/08/2000 al 31/12/2009 azienda 4 <<< qui viene spezzato il periodo in base alla listview2
la quarta riga sara 01/01/2010 al 04/05/2010 azienda 4 <<< qui il periodo ricomincia in base alla listview2
la sesta riga sara 05/05/2010 al 30/09/2016 aziena5

Chiedo una mano perchè non so proprio come fare.
Grazie in anticipo

Mau67
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?

Dopo esserti registrato potrai chiedere
aiuto sul nostro Forum oppure aiutare gli altri

Consulta le Stanze disponibili.

Registrati ora !
Copyright © dotNetHell.it 2002-2024
Running on Windows Server 2008 R2 Standard, SQL Server 2012 & ASP.NET 3.5